Carnauba wax (E903) - what is it?
Carnauba wax, also known as E903, is a natural wax extracted from the leaves of the Brazilian palm tree Copernicia prunifera. Considered one of the hardest known natural waxes, it is characterized by its high gloss, which makes it highly valued in various industries. This wax is completely biodegradable and considered a safe food additive.
Its unique structure provides excellent protection and polishing properties, making it indispensable in a wide range of applications, from food to automotive and cosmetics.
Properties of Carnauba Wax
Carnauba wax is extremely resistant to water and heat, making it ideal for use in products that require protection from moisture and heat. It also has excellent binding and emulsifying properties, making it easy to use in a variety of product formulations.
Carnauba Wax Applications
In the food industry, E903 is often used as a glazing agent, added to candies, chocolate-covered fruits, and bakery products to give them a glossy finish. In addition, due to its protective properties, it is used in chewing gum production as a separator to prevent products from sticking together.

Carnauba wax and its functions in food
In the food industry, Carnauba wax plays a key role as a glazing agent, giving products an attractive, glossy appearance. Its natural resistance to heat and moisture makes it an ideal choice for protecting food quality and shelf life. Additionally, as a natural product, it is safe and acceptable to consumers seeking products with minimal synthetic additives.
